Company summary

Norris Furniture & Interiors is a visionary furniture company that has been revolutionizing the world of interior design and home furnishings for over three decades. With its headquarters situated in Fort Myers, Florida, this esteemed organization has established itself as a preeminent authority in the region, serving clients across Southwest Florida's major markets, including Naples and Sarasota.

Founded in 1985 by an entrepreneurial spirit, Norris Furniture & Interiors has evolved into a leading player in the furniture industry, earning its reputation through exceptional quality, innovative design, and unwavering commitment to customer satisfaction. The company boasts an impressive employee base of approximately 51-200 dedicated professionals who are passionate about delivering outstanding results.
